Portable and mobile RF communications equipment can affect the AA222. Install and operate the AA222
according to the EMC information presented in this chapter. The AA222 has been tested for EMC emissions
and immunity as a standalone AA222. Do not use the AA222 adjacent to or stacked with other electronic
equipment. If adjacent or stacked use is necessary, the user should verify normal operation in the
configuration.
The use of accessories, transducers and cables other than those specified, with the exception of servicing
parts sold by Interacoustics as replacement parts for internal components, may result in increased
EMISSIONS or decreased IMMUNITY of the device.
Anyone connecting additional equipment is responsible for making sure the system complies with the IEC
60601-1-2 standard.

Recommended separation distances between portable and mobile RF communications equipment and the AA222.
The AA222 is intended for use in an electromagnetic environment in which radiated RF disturbances are controlled. The
customer or the user of the AA222 can help prevent electromagnetic interferences by maintaining a minimum distance
between portable and mobile RF communications equipment (transmitters) and the AA222 as recommended below,
according to the maximum output power of the communications equipment.

For transmitters rated at a maximum output power not listed above, the recommended separation distance d in meters
(m) can be estimated using the equation applicable to the frequency of the transmitter, where P is the maximum output
power rating of the transmitter in watts (W) according to the transmitter manufacturer.

Electromagnetic environment - guidance
The AA222 uses RF energy only for its internal function.
Therefore, its RF emissions are very low and are not likely to
cause any interference in nearby electronic equipment.
The AA222 is suitable for use in all commercial, industrial,
business, and residential environments.
